The Industry Insights: Data and Consumer Engagement

Recent data from Newzoo indicates that mobile gaming revenue surpassed $100 billion globally in 2023, accounting for over 50% of total games market revenue (see Newzoo industry reports). Among various genres, puzzle games notably retain high user engagement metrics, characterized by long session durations and high retention rates.

For example, titles like “Candy Crush Saga” and “Homescapes” illustrate how simple mechanics combined with social features generate daily active users in the tens of millions. Such titles have evolved into platforms for community interaction, in-app monetization, and even esports tournaments, blurring lines between casual entertainment and competitive gaming.

Design Elements and Player Retention Strategies

Expert developers prioritize intuitive interfaces, incremental difficulty, and rewarding incentives—components fundamental to sustained engagement. Analyzing successful titles reveals best practices such as:

  • Colorful, appealing visual themes: Vibrant aesthetics that catch the eye and motivate continued play.
  • Progress systems and unlockables: Levels, achievements, and daily challenges incentivize habitual engagement.
  • Social integrations: Sharing scores and competitive leaderboards foster community and virality.

These elements underpin gamer psychology, tapping into intrinsic motivations and fostering habit-forming behaviors. They are essential considerations for any game aiming to build brand loyalty within volatile markets.

Mobile Puzzle Games as a Platform for Innovation

In recent years, some developers have pushed the boundaries of traditional puzzle mechanics by integrating augmented reality, machine learning, and cross-platform gameplay. These innovations not only enhance user experience but also open new monetization channels and partnership opportunities.

Furthermore, with the rise of niche subgenres such as match-3, tile-matching, and logic puzzles, developers are exploring diverse thematic settings to appeal to specific consumer segments. This diversification fosters a richer ecosystem, encouraging players to explore multiple titles, thus driving retention and lifetime value (LTV).

Case Study: Market Entry and User Acquisition Strategies

Effectively launching a mobile puzzle game entails strategic promotion, onboarding, and continuous updates. According to industry sources, the success often hinges on leveraging app store optimization (ASO), influencer partnerships, and targeted advertising campaigns.

Some studios also employ gamified onboarding processes that demonstrate core mechanics, ensuring players quickly grasp gameplay and become engaged. In this context, maintaining a steady flow of fresh content and listening to community feedback are crucial to adapting to evolving user preferences.
